Output c5bab342413bb9c981b85e4b5499323fb80c6ca1a86b91569fd2f007fc70234c:0

value
2051677
script pubkey
OP_0 OP_PUSHBYTES_20 aab27ccb9f98dbbad7cd0c6dd354d82be80366c8
address
bc1q42e8ejulnrdm447dp3kax4xc905qxekgtt2dlr
transaction
c5bab342413bb9c981b85e4b5499323fb80c6ca1a86b91569fd2f007fc70234c
confirmations
320183
spent
true